Pristine Waters: shut-Loop Cooling and Zero Wastewater Discharge

Water is a cherished resource, and its use in industrial cooling has historically been A significant supply of usage and opportunity pollution. Open-loop cooling units typically discharge heated or chemically dealt with h2o, while even some shut-loop systems can include coolants that pose disposal troubles.

The hallmark of a truly cleanse cooling Option lies in its approach to the cooling medium, ordinarily water. Highly developed programs champion the notion of shut-circuit water cooling:

completely Enclosed h2o units: The cooling h2o circulates in just a completely sealed loop. It passes underneath the cooling surface area (like a steel belt), absorbs warmth from your merchandise indirectly, and it is then re-cooled and recirculated. There is no immediate connection with the products and no discharge to exterior h2o bodies or municipal sewer programs.

Reusable Coolant: Because the h2o continues to be contained and uncontaminated by the product or service, it can be reused indefinitely with small top-up required to compensate for small evaporation inside the cooling unit itself (not from the process). This substantially decreases All round drinking water usage, a critical factor in water-scarce locations or for companies aiming for drinking water stewardship.

Elimination of Chemical remedy and Disposal charges: Because the cooling drinking water does not mix Along with the product or service or turn into closely fouled, the need for intense chemical treatment options (biocides, anti-scaling brokers) is considerably minimized or eradicated. This, subsequently, gets rid of the sizeable expenses and environmental threats connected to treating and disposing of chemical-laden wastewater.

This solution not just conserves water and guards aquatic ecosystems but also offers major operational Charge financial savings.

solution Integrity confident: The Zero Cross-Contamination Promise

For industries like meals processing, prescribed drugs, and good substances, product purity is non-negotiable. Any conversation between the product as well as the cooling medium, or residues from earlier batches, may result in contamination, batch rejection, and intense reputational harm.

clean up cooling systems, Specifically Those people using indirect cooling surfaces like chrome steel belts, are made with product or service integrity for a paramount worry:

full merchandise-Coolant Isolation: The products is solidified on 1 aspect of the sanitary, impervious barrier (the steel belt), whilst the cooling medium (water) circulates on the opposite. This Actual physical separation assures there is totally no chance of the cooling h2o or any contaminants it'd theoretically carry (however not likely in a very cleanse, shut procedure) coming into contact with the product. The item's chemical composition, purity, and qualities stay unchanged.

perfect for Sensitive Industries: This would make this sort of units extremely perfectly-fitted to applications the place even trace contamination is unacceptable. food items-quality merchandise, Lively pharmaceutical elements (APIs), and high-purity specialty chemical compounds could be processed with self confidence.

Compliance with Stringent expectations: the look rules align properly with the requirements of fine Manufacturing tactics (GMP), Hazard Assessment and significant Management Points (HACCP), and FDA regulations, which all emphasize protecting against contamination and guaranteeing solution safety and top quality.

This assurance of contamination-absolutely free processing is often a cornerstone of modern, higher-price manufacturing.

Hygienic style & easy routine maintenance: The effectiveness Equation

servicing and cleaning are unavoidable aspects of any industrial operation. nonetheless, the design on the products can substantially affect time, energy, and price included. techniques with sophisticated geometries, really hard-to-get to locations, or People at risk of leakage and residue Construct-up may become a servicing load.

clean up cooling answers usually function hygienic style and design rules:

Minimized Residue and Leakage: The enclosed nature in the cooling medium and the smooth, non-porous surfaces employed for item contact (like chrome steel belts in the flaker equipment) necessarily mean nominal probabilities for item residue to accumulate in hidden spots or for cooling medium to leak.

uncomplicated-to-clear Surfaces: Stainless steel, a typical substance in substantial-top quality cooling belts, is renowned for its cleanability and resistance to corrosion and microbial advancement. sleek surfaces without crevices avoid material build-up and make wipe-down or wash-down strategies fast and powerful.

lessened routine maintenance Downtime and expenses: less difficult cleansing interprets straight to much less downtime. On top of that, the robustness of very well-made techniques, with less factors of opportunity failure relevant to emissions or effluent administration, leads to reduced overall maintenance fees and enhanced operational uptime.

Suitability for top-Hygiene purposes: These functions are indispensable in sectors like toddler formula manufacturing or maybe the producing of pharmaceutical syrups, where by the very best amounts of hygiene are mandated to prevent any form of contamination. A hygienic flaker or cooler style and design is key.

buying machines that is not hard to wash and keep is an financial commitment in very long-term operational performance and products top quality.
